About Us:The Warehouse Group (TWG) is a New Zealand success story, founded by Sir Stephen Tindall and evolved from a single The Warehouse store to become one of the largest retailing groups in New Zealand with $3 billion in sales. TWG consists of six core retail brands: The Warehouse, Warehouse Stationery, Noel Leeming, Torpedo7, 1-day and TheMarket. We have 260+ retail stores, online stores as well as distribution centres throughout New Zealand. We also have two overseas sourcing offices located in China and India. We are a people-centred business with more than 12,000 team members across our locations.About the Role:Reporting to the DC Manager, you will be responsible for maintaining resourcing and productivity benchmarking models and working with leaders to understand and manage labour utilisation. You will play an essential role in supporting the delivery of productivity and process improvement projects and undertaking detailed and thorough logistics analysis to identify opportunities that aid efficiency and cost optimisation.Other responsibilities include (but are not limited to) :Develop and automate productivity and labour allocation KPI reporting to support operational performance management.Produce regular simplified reporting for the Operations team to enable them to accurately forecast labour and to easily identify trends and potential issuesCreate statistical and financial models to review opportunities for cost savings and efficiencies in the logistics processAbout You:Advanced analytical & modelling skillsExperience in forecasting and planning rolesAbility to think both logically and creatively, a business-focused approach, high degree of organization and a commitment to continuous learning.Effective internal relationship buildingStrong understanding of operational labour managementMore About Us:This role is will require you to work 40 hours per week.
